learn how to use documentation and how to plan to solve given tasks. All examples and tasks will be performed using C programing language using an integrated development environment of choice. For its generality and emphasis on designing algorithms, this course is suitable for students with interest in other programming languages as well. |

Program; algorithm;
program development; debugging;
integrated development environment;
basic example; data types;
expressions; basic commands; mathematical functions;
conditional expressions; branching;
loops; arrays;
strings;
functions; recursive functions. |
